The City may discontinue reclaimed water service to any customer due to an infraction of the reclaimed water system's procedures and regulations, non-payment of bills, for tampering with any service, plumbing cross-connections with another water source or for any reason deemed to be detrimental to the reclaimed water system. The City has the right to cease service until the conditions corrected and all costs and fees due to the City are paid. These costs and fees may include delinquent billings, connection charges and payment for any damage caused to the system.
Should a discontinued service be turned on without authorization, the City shall remove the service and impose an additional charge for removal.
There is a $75 fee for discontinuing reclaimed water service. The preferred method to discontinue service, is to complete the Reclaimed Water Activation & Deactivation Online Form. However, if you are experiencing technical difficulties, you can either visit us at the SPB Library for assistance or print the form and mail it with a check payable to SPB. This written request shall be addressed to:
City of St. Pete Beach, Attn: Finance Department
155 Corey Avenue
St. Pete Beach, FL 33706
All current bills shall be paid by the customer including a bill for the use of reclaimed water during the period up to the physical discontinuation of service. There is a fee of $75 to resume/re-connect the service.
